**Your Role**:
As a Senior EHS Specialist you will work in a small team to drive a developing safety culture in a Cell Culture Media production facility. Aligning with our High Impact Culture you will support the introduction of new products by reviewing raw material and finished goods safety and review current systems of work. You will help define and implement EHS strategies, provide training, and monitor risk assessments. Your responsibilities will include ensuring compliance with regulations, conducting internal and external audits, and supporting incident investigations. A committed advocate for EHS improvements, you will support emergency response drills and champion Be Safe and Be Healthy programs. Serving as a central point of contact for regulatory bodies, you will assist in reviewing the safety of contractors on site, emphasizing your dedication to safety and environmental excellence.

**Who You Are**:

- Minimum NEBOSH Diploma or equivalent in safety management (Essential)
- Degree or Equivalent in Biological or Chemical Science or Engineering (Desirable)
- Minimum of 5 years industry experience
- Experience of driving EHS improvements
- Experience of working in an environment where hazardous substances can be used
- Experience working in a GMP or manufacturing environment is desirable
